做前端web用什么工具
-
在前端web开发中,有许多工具可以帮助我们更高效地进行开发。下面是几个常用的工具:
-
编辑器:用于编写代码的工具,常见的编辑器有VS Code、Sublime Text、Atom等。这些编辑器具有代码高亮、智能提示、代码片段等功能,可以提升开发效率。
-
前端框架:前端框架可以让我们更快速地搭建网页或应用程序。常见的前端框架有React、Angular和Vue.js。这些框架提供了丰富的组件库和开发工具,可以简化开发流程。
-
包管理工具:包管理工具可以帮助我们管理项目所需的依赖包,并自动安装和更新它们。常见的包管理工具有npm和yarn。通过这些工具,我们可以轻松地安装第三方库和插件,提高开发效率。
-
调试工具:调试工具可以帮助我们定位和修复代码错误。浏览器自带的开发者工具是常用的调试工具,可以查看网页元素、调试JavaScript代码、网络请求等。此外,还有一些第三方调试工具,如Chrome DevTools和Firefox Developer Tools,提供了更丰富的功能。
-
构建工具:构建工具可以将源代码转换、压缩、打包等,生成用于生产环境的代码文件。常见的构建工具有Webpack和Parcel。这些工具可以帮助我们优化代码,减少加载时间,提高网页性能。
-
版本控制工具:版本控制工具可以帮助我们管理代码的版本和变化。Git是最常用的版本控制工具,可以跟踪代码的修改、回滚和合并等操作。通过版本控制工具,多人协作开发变得更加方便。
-
测试工具:测试工具可以帮助我们保证代码的质量和稳定性。常见的前端测试工具有Jest和Mocha,可以进行单元测试、集成测试等。这些工具可以自动化执行测试用例,并生成测试报告。
除了以上提到的工具,还有很多其他的工具可以帮助我们在前端web开发中更加高效和便捷地工作。根据具体的需求和项目情况,选择适合自己的工具,可以提升开发效率,提高代码质量。
2年前 -
-
在做前端web开发时,有很多工具可以帮助我们提高效率和质量。以下是我推荐的一些常用工具:
-
编辑器/集成开发环境(IDE):Web开发的首要工具就是一个好用的编辑器或IDE。一些流行的选择包括Visual Studio Code、Sublime Text、Atom等。这些工具都提供了丰富的功能,如代码自动补全、语法高亮显示、版本控制等,可以帮助我们更轻松地编写和维护代码。
-
浏览器开发者工具:主流的浏览器都提供了内置的开发者工具,如Chrome的开发者工具、Firefox的Firebug等。这些工具可以帮助我们调试和优化网页,查看网页结构、样式和性能,修改和实时预览代码等。
-
版本控制工具:在团队协作或个人开发中使用版本控制系统是很重要的。Git是目前最流行的版本控制工具,它可以帮助我们管理代码的版本、提交和合并代码、解决代码冲突等。GitHub和GitLab等托管平台可以帮助我们远程存储和分享代码。
-
包管理工具:在前端开发中,我们通常会使用一些第三方的库和框架来加快开发速度。包管理工具可以帮助我们方便地安装、更新和管理这些依赖项。目前最常用的前端包管理工具是npm(Node Package Manager),它是Node.js的默认包管理工具,也可以用于前端开发。
-
前端框架和库:前端开发中常用的框架和库有很多,比如React、Angular、Vue等。这些框架和库提供了一套丰富的组件和工具,可以帮助我们快速构建功能强大的网页应用程序。选择适合自己的框架和库,可以显著提高开发效率和代码质量。
总之,前端web开发是一个需要使用多种工具的领域。选择适合自己工作风格和项目需求的工具是非常重要的,这些工具可以帮助我们更轻松地编写、调试和维护代码,提高开发效率和代码质量。
2年前 -
-
前端开发是指构建和设计网页界面的过程,在开发过程中需要使用一些工具来提高效率和便利性。以下是一些常用的前端开发工具。
-
文本编辑器:
文本编辑器是前端开发的基本工具,用于编写HTML、CSS和JavaScript代码。常用的文本编辑器包括Visual Studio Code、Sublime Text、Atom等,它们具备代码高亮、语法检查、代码片段等功能,提供了良好的编码环境。 -
浏览器开发工具:
现代浏览器都内置了开发者工具,可以通过按F12或右键菜单打开。浏览器开发工具包括元素面板、网络面板、控制台、源码调试等功能,可以实时查看和修改网页的结构、CSS样式、 JavaScript代码等,方便调试和修改。 -
版本控制工具:
版本控制是协作开发时不可或缺的工具。常用的版本控制工具包括Git和SVN。通过版本控制工具,可以跟踪和管理代码的修改历史,方便团队成员之间的协作和代码管理。 -
包管理工具:
前端开发通常会使用很多第三方库和框架,如jQuery、React、Vue等。包管理工具可以帮助我们更好地管理和安装这些库和框架。常用的包管理工具有NPM(Node Package Manager)和Yarn。 -
自动化构建工具:
在前端开发中,经常需要进行代码压缩、合并、转换、打包等操作。自动化构建工具可以帮助我们简化这些操作,提高开发效率。常用的自动化构建工具有Webpack、Grunt和Gulp。 -
图片编辑工具:
在前端开发中,经常需要对图片进行裁剪、压缩、优化等操作。常用的图片编辑工具包括Adobe Photoshop、Sketch、GIMP等。 -
在线调试工具:
有时候我们需要在不同的设备和浏览器上进行调试,检查网页在不同环境下的表现。常用的在线调试工具包括JSFiddle、CodePen、JS Bin等。
除了上述工具,前端开发还会使用一些辅助工具,如代码检查工具(ESLint、JSLint)、代码生成工具(Yeoman)、移动端调试工具(Chrome移动端模拟器)等。选择工具时根据个人喜好、项目需求和团队合作方式综合考虑。
2年前 -